Omega-3s may delay aging by reprogramming energy metabolism

[ad_1]

Information from the mouse examine confirmed that omega-3s, and EPA (eicosapentaenoic acid) specifically, could activate PPAR-alpha (peroxisome proliferator–activated receptor-alpha), which performs an necessary function in quite a lot of features, together with vitality and lipid metabolism, irritation, mind operate and diabetes.

The fatty acids have been additionally related to elevations within the manufacturing of ATP (Adenosine triphosphate), the vitality supply for tissues, reported scientists from Southern Medical College (Guangzhou), Zhejiang College (Hangzhou), and Guangdong College of Know-how (Guangzhou).

“Our analysis confirms the anti-aging results of omega-3 PUFAs in a number of organs and supplies robust proof to assist the thought of every day supplementation of omega-3 PUFAs, with warning of efficient varieties and purity, to assist wholesome getting old,” they wrote in Pharmacological Analysis.

Commenting independently on the examine’s findings, Harry Rice, PhD, VP of regulatory and scientific affairs on the World Group for EPA and DHA Omega-3s (GOED), informed NutraIngredients: “The current outcomes are intriguing, to say the least. If extra analysis finds the current outcomes might be generalized to people, that would supply but another reason to take a every day EPA/DHA wealthy complement.

“At the moment, when you’re on the lookout for a compelling purpose to take an EPA/DHA wealthy complement to decelerate the getting old course of, contemplate the research demonstrating that EPA/DHA attenuates the shortening of telomeres​.

“As a fast primer, telomere size shortens with age, and shorter telomeres have been related to elevated incidence of ailments.
